tcp 三次握手分析,wireshark分析三次握手

5.2、tcp三次握手详细分析,通过抓包分析TCP-2握手 。Why-2握手问题1:tcpWhy三次握手,TCP的三次,tcp三次握手交换了什么信息?TCP协议三次握手process分析TCP(传输控制协议传输控制协议(TCP)是主机到主机层的传输控制协议,提供可靠的连接服务,使用三次 握手确认位码为tcp flag位建立连接 。
【tcp 三次握手分析,wireshark分析三次握手】
1、TCP 三次 握手机制中的seq和ack的值到底是什么意思?seq和ack号存在于TCP段的报头中,其中seq是序列号,ack是确认号 , 大小都是4个字节 。Seq: 4个字节,序列号范围至少这么正常三次双方都可以知道并确认对方的初始序列号 , 也就是说主机1告诉主机2序列号,主机2回复主机1已经收到你的序列号,告诉主机1我的初始序列号是多少 。主机1收到主机2发来的序列号后,告诉主机2我收到了你的序列号 。我们来看看这个三次 握手在一个特殊的情况下是如何处理的:此时主机2会向主机1发送一个确认,询问这个包是否真的存在,而主机2会识别出过期数据包的序列号是错误的,并忽略它 。

2、TCP 三次 握手的工作原理及意义发送方向接收方发送连接建立请求消息,接收方以连接建立请求消息的确认消息响应发送方,发送方向接收方发送队列确认消息的确认消息 。TCP第一次握手:建立连接时,客户端发送一个syn包(synj)给服务器,进入SYN_SEND状态 , 等待服务器确认;第二次握手:服务器收到syn包时 , 必须确认客户的SYN(ackj 1),并自己发送一个SYN包(SYN ACK包) 。此时服务器进入SYN_RECV状态;

3、什么是TCP连接 三次 握手?TCP需要-2握手来建立连接 , 那么为什么-2握手?在TCP/IP协议中,TCP提供可靠的连接服务,使用-2握手建立连接 。第一次握手:建立连接时,客户端发送一个syn包(synj)给服务器,进入SYN_SEND状态,等待服务器确认;SYN: SynchronizeSequenceNumbers 。

4、为什么是 三次 握手问题1:tcpWhy/三次握手 。TCP-1/ 。TCP的三次 握手最重要的是防止过期的连接再次传输到被连接的 。如果使用两次 , 会出现以下情况 。比如电脑A想连接电脑B,结果发送的连接信息因为某种原因没有到达电脑B;于是,a机又发了一次,这次B收到了,于是他回了一条信息,两台机器就连上了 。完成后,断开连接 。结果这个时候,原本没到的连接信息突然到了B机 , 于是B机给A发了一条消息,然后B机以为和A连接上了,这个时候B机在等A发东西 。

    推荐阅读